功能复合添加剂对牛粪厌氧发酵的影响
Effect of the functional composite additives of dairy manure on anaerobic fermentation
摘要
Abstract
To shorten the digestion time and to improve biogas production rate and COD degradation rate in the process of anaerobic fermentation of dairy manure,functional additives such as urea,urea/bentonite,and urea/activated carbon were added into the anaerobic fermentation,and then the influence of addition of these functional additive(The addition of these functional additive is calculated by mass ratio of wet dairy manure) on anaerobic fermentation of dairy manure were investigated.The results showed that:as compared with the control group,the relative cumulative biogas yield from the experimental groups with addition of urea(0.3%),urea(0.3%) and bentonite(0.6%),urea(0.3%) and activated carbon (0.8%) were enhanced by 0.54%,33.97% and 54.90%,respectively.And the relative COD degradation rates from the experimental groups with addition of urea (0.3%),urea (0.3%) and bentonite (0.9%),urea (0.3%) and activated carbon (0.9%) were 41.35%,103.75% and 13.43%,respectively.By adding the functional additive into the anaerobic fermentation,the anaerobic digestion time was shorten,biogas yield rate and COD degradation rate were increased significantly,which indicated the that synergetic effects among the different components of the composite functional additives play a significant role in promoting the anaerobic fermentation.关键词
